Timothy P. Banse draws on his extensive travels and Defense Language Institute training to make Puerto Rican Spanish approachable for newcomers. This book breaks down unique slang words and phrases you'll actually hear on the streets, from ordering food to hailing a taxi, without overwhelming you with grammar lessons. For example, it explains expressions like "A fuego" to mean "really cool" and "Echa pa' ca" as a casual way to beckon someone over. If you want to connect with locals and avoid sounding like a textbook speaker, this guide offers a compact, pocket-sized introduction ideal for quick learning and travel use. It's suited for beginners who want conversational familiarity rather than a full language course.

This book offers a practical dive into the informal side of Spanish as spoken in Spain, focusing on 102 commonly used slang and curse words. Digital Polyglot, driven by a mission to break language barriers and promote cultural understanding, provides detailed explanations including origin stories and usage contexts for each expression. The inclusion of 21 dialogues centered on a young woman’s life in Barcelona helps you see these words in action, making it easier to grasp their nuances. If you have at least an A2 level in Spanish and want to sound more like a native, this book bridges the gap between textbook Spanish and everyday speech.
